How have societies interacted with one and other over time? How do we manage the relationships and conflicts between nations? What impact has globalisation had on our political economies and cultures? These are all profound questions of the modern world we live in.
To understand the contemporary challenges that exist in our world, we must understand the geographies, politics, histories and relations that have shaped our environment. In this course, you will investigate how democracies operate, how our world is shaped by dominant ideas of capitalism and colonialism, and how historical events affect current affairs.
You will study topics including but not limited to:
War, and the war on terror
International relations
Political power
Globalisation
Migration

Study abroad
Your education extends beyond the university campus. We support you in expanding your education through offering the opportunity to spend a year or a term studying abroad at one of our partner universities. The four-year version of our degree allows you to spend the third year abroad or employed on a placement abroad, while otherwise remaining identical to the three-year course.
Studying abroad allows you to experience other cultures and languages, to broaden your degree socially and academically, and to demonstrate to employers that you are mature, adaptable, and organised.
If you spend a full year abroad you'll only pay 15% of your usual tuition fee to Essex for that year. You won't pay any tuition fees to your host university.
Placement year
When you arrive at Essex, you can decide whether you would like to combine your course with a placement year. You will be responsible for finding your placement, but with support and guidance provided by both your department and our Employability and Careers Centre.
If you complete a placement year you'll only pay 20% of your usual tuition fee to Essex for that year.
